Chris,

The LoP message indicates that there is not enough power to tune the KAT2.

As your first troubleshooting test, unplug the KAT2 (both cables) and
try again - connect a dummy load to the lower BNC jack on the base K2.

See if you get power output on 10 meters.  If not, look carefully at the
bandpass filter for 10/12 meters.

If the bandpass filter is OK, then you will have to do Transmit Signal
Tracing.  Build the RF Probe if you have not already done that and turn
to the Troubleshooting appendix in the manual.  Do the troubleshooting
on page 14.  Use 10 meters instead of 40 meters, and tell me at which
point the RF voltage is significantly (more than 10%) less than the
expected voltage.
